Comparing Nylon Belts with Other Material Options

2026 How to Choose the Best Nylon Weightlifting Belt?

When choosing a nylon weightlifting belt, it’s essential to consider how it compares to other materials like leather and suede. Nylon belts are lightweight and flexible. This makes them a popular choice for those new to weightlifting. They offer basic support for the lower back and can keep you comfortable during workouts. However, some lifters may find them less rigid compared to leather options.

Leather belts provide superior stiffness and durability, essential for heavy lifting. They do not stretch much, which offers maximum support. On the other hand, they can feel bulkier. Then there’s suede, which combines elements of both leather and nylon. Suede belts often provide a softer feel while still offering decent support. Yet, they can wear down faster, especially with frequent use.

Weightlifting belts, regardless of material, need to be fitted correctly for safety. A poorly fitting belt can lead to discomfort or injury. Maintenance Tips to Extend the Life of Your Weightlifting Belt

Proper maintenance of your nylon weightlifting belt can significantly extend its lifespan. A well-cared belt can last several years, but neglect can lead to premature wear. After each use, clean your belt with mild soap and water to remove sweat and grime. Allow it to air dry completely. Avoid direct sunlight, as UV rays can weaken nylon fibers over time. Even the best belts can fray if exposed to harsh conditions. Storing your belt properly is essential. Place it flat or rolled loosely in a cool, dry place. Hanging it could stretch the material, leading to a loss of support when lifting.

Regular inspections are vital as well. Look for signs of fraying or damage. Small issues can escalate if not addressed. This attention to detail can save you from making costly replacements. Remember, a little care today can yield a stronger performance tomorrow.
